Warning Signs You Need HVAC Leak Water Removal

You might be thinking, “What are the warning signs that I need HVAC leak water removal?” The answer is simple: if you notice water pooling around your HVAC system, or if you smell musty odors coming from your vents, it’s time to act. Don’t ignore the signs the longer you wait, the more damage you’ll incur, and the more expensive the repairs will be.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Musty odors in your home can be a sign of a more serious issue. If you notice a persistent, unpleasant smell coming from your vents or ducts, it’s likely due to mold growth. Don’t wait to address the issue mold can spread quickly, causing serious health problems and costly repairs.

Water Pooling Around Your HVAC System

Water pooling around your HVAC system is a clear sign that something is wrong. Don’t underestimate the power of early detection if you notice water collecting near your system, it’s time to call a professional. Our team will assess the situation and provide a plan to fix the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of a more serious issue. Don’t ignore the signs water damage can compromise the structural integrity of your home, leading to costly repairs and even safety hazards.

Discolored Paint or Drywall

Discolored paint or drywall can be a sign of water damage. Don’t wait to address the issue the longer you wait, the more damage you’ll incur, and the more expensive the repairs will be.

HVAC Leak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Pro

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small leak with minimal damage Yes No You can handle the cleanup and repair yourself, but be sure to act quickly to prevent further damage.
Large leak with extensive damage No Yes Professional help is necessary to contain the damage and prevent further complications.
Unknown source of the leak No Yes You’ll need a professional to identify the source of the leak and develop a plan to fix the issue.
High-risk area for mold growth No Yes Professional help is necessary to prevent the growth of mold and mildew in high-risk areas.
Water damage to electrical systems No Yes Water damage to electrical systems can be hazardous, call a pro to ensure your safety and the safety of your home.
Water damage to structural elements No Yes Water damage to structural elements can compromise the integrity of your home, call a pro to ensure your safety and the safety of your home.

HVAC Leak Water Removal Cost In Sansom Park, TX

The cost of HVAC le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Sansom Park, TX. These estimates are based on real-world costs and may not reflect the final price of your project. Get a free estimate from our team today to find out the cost of your specific project.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ed
Cleaning and sanitizing $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ed
Restoration and reconstruction $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and materials needed
Emergency services (24/7) 10% – 20% of total cost Severity of damage, time of day, and technician’s expertise

How long does the drying process take?

The drying process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our technicians will work with you to develop a plan to ensure that your space is dry and safe.

Can I prevent water damage from my HVAC system?

Yes, you can prevent water damage from your HVAC system by regular maintenance and inspections. Be sure to check your system regularly and address any issues quickly to prevent costly repairs and safety hazards.
